Load TestingThe Department of Defense is conducting market research through a Sources Sought notice to identify qualified small businesses capable of providing annual proof testing and load test services for critical aerospace ground equipment used with the C-5 Galaxy aircraft. The testing will focus on engine handling and Auxiliary Power Unit (APU) hoisting equipment, including bootstrap beam assemblies, bootstrap beam hoists, and APU lifting hoists located at Westover Air Reserve Base, Massachusetts. The government intends to establish a five-year Blanket Purchase Agreement to cover this recurring maintenance requirement, which includes structural and mechanical proof load testing, non-destructive inspections to certify equipment integrity, and providing official certification documentation. Interested vendors must submit a capability statement by June 30, 2026, detailing company information, socioeconomic status under NAICS 811310, relevant technical expertise with AGSE or comparable equipment, and examples of past performance with similar load testing contracts. Vendors must clarify whether testing will be conducted on-site at Westover ARB or off-site at a certified facility, as transportation capabilities may be required. This opportunity is set aside for total small business participation, and responses must be submitted electronically to the Department of Defense point of contact, Robert E. Stacy, by the specified deadline. The notice is strictly for information gathering and does not constitute a commitment or solicitation for proposals.

This contract involves performing structural repairs on aircraft skin as part of a full restoration effort, specifically focusing on sheet metal patching and fiberglass reinforcement. The work requires that all repairs match the aircraft's original appearance and hardware to maintain authenticity and ensure quality. The contract is a subcontract issued by the Department of Defense, with the place of performance at the USAF Academy. The solicitation is a Total Small Business Set-Aside under FAR 19.5, indicating that only qualifying small businesses may submit responses. The NAICS code assigned is 811310, corresponding to commercial and industrial machinery and equipment repair and maintenance services. The contract was posted on May 18, 2026, with a response deadline set for May 26, 2026. This opportunity is targeted toward companies capable of meeting detailed restoration requirements within a military context.
